Oscar Hiram Lipps worked at the Carlisle Indian School in Pennsylvania, was superintendent of the Nez Perce Agency, was superintendent at the Chemawa Indian School, and was a field representative of the U. S. Indian Service. He wrote a two volume book on the Navajo. The University of Oregon has a collection of his papers. Lipps was born in Fayette, Indiana. He studied in Harriman, Tennessee.
